    Lately we've seen a number of these. Most are just high school science experiments but there are also genuine ones. As you can see I only paid $1.00 for it at my LCS but I can assure you without looking it up that they cost more originally.

    This is a JFK 24 kt. Gold plated Half Dollar. It commentates the 25th anniversary of his election to the office of the presidency. It is dual dated and 1960 the year he was elected, is above IN GOD. 1985 is just above WE TRUST which is 25 years, hence the anniversary.

    The second photo says it all. Please read it carefully. This is not original government packaging. The half is from the Mint, as it reads, issued by the United States Mint. It's also numbered so there are a number of them out there. Maybe that's why we've seen a number of them.
